Loras was born in the mountains of the High Forest to two druid parents of renown in their circle. He received druidic education at a young age and was expected to rise through the ranks and join his guardians once he completed his training. But Loras always knew he was meant for greater things; better, more powerful magic.He's drawn to arcane magic instead of the primal and studied it in secret with whatever books and scrolls he could find. One day, a wizard named Vespin Chloras passed through the land. The two connected and the wizard promised to teach Loras arcane arts.This went on for some time. Loras was deeply invested in the arcane secrets Vespin revealed, and Vespin became especially interested in the ancient elemental orb guarded by the druids.– What if they could extract the power of the orb and harness the elemental forces through arcane means?They worked on their theory, studied and experimented until they had a blueprint for application. Loras helped Vespin bypass the ward protecting the orb, and the two put their theory to test ...That's when the accident occurred. The raw force of the elements went out of control and caused a magical explosion. Loras was injured in the process, leaving a permanent scar on the right side of his face.Vespin disappeared after the incident. Loras faced trial and was excommunicated from the circle. He left the mountains and headed to Baldur's Gate, determined to continue his arcane studies there. That's when the mind flayer ship invaded, and Loras became among those kidnapped and infected with a tadpole on the naultiloid ...

Every mage in Faerun has heard of the name Karsus, the child-who-would-be-god and his folly that broke the magic of the world. But what of Vespin Chloras, Left Hand of Asmodeus? The infernal devil mage was once a man ...Born in the same era as Karsus, an archmage by the name Vespin Chloras, too, dedicated his life to unlock the secret of godhood. Like Karsus, Vespin believed to become a god one must kill a god and take their place in the pantheon. Unlike Karsus, who was after Magic itself, Vespin believed that his Ritual of Ascension would be best used if he replaced and rid the world of an evil god.He set his eyes on Asmodeus, the Lord of the Nine Hells himself, which was his first and last mistake.The spell was less than perfect, and Asmodeus easily overcame it, bringing Vespin to his knees in an instant. Enraged by the mortal's insolent attempt, Asmodeus peered into Vespin's mind for his deepest, darkest fears.In his dying moment, Vespin felt the intense regret and sense of loneliness, and begged not to be forgotten. Identifying his ammunition, Asmodeus decimated Vespin's city and wiped it from existence – everything he had worked for, his life, his accomplishments, his studies and his sanctum, gone, along with thousands of lives and hundreds of years of history.Asmodeus then twisted Vespin's form and made him into a devil, peeling off his skin so he was but a faceless, nameless monster of the hells. Simply known as the Left Hand of Asmodeus, he had since been bound to Asmodeus for eternity ...The Lord of the Hells never let Vespin forget about his mistake. Occasionally, he will free Vespin from his control and send him up to the Material Plane after magical intrigues that will inevitably end in disaster, proving to Vespin time and again that he's a broken man and will always make the same mistake.Vespin's torment seemed endless. Then a naultiloid crashed through Avernus. As a devil of the hells, Vespin was sent to respond. That's where he met an infected host / [Tav], who with their strange new psychic ability could free Vespin from Asmodeus' control ...

If Sukree had a soul coin every time he woke up in a strange cocoon covered in questionable fluids, feeling vaguely changed ... he would have two soul coins. Which was quite a bit as far as minted souls go, and definitely weird that it happened twice.Sukree didn't remember anything from before the first time this happened. He woke up in the mountains with a bunch of druids fussing over him. He was in some kind of a healing pod. They said there had been an accident. Sukree was exposed to an ungodly amount of arcane magic and elemental forces, that they barely saved him but he didn't have much longer left to live.Prognosis: five to ten years. And that's being optimistic.As a fairly young half-elf (he thinks), this was devastating news. But Sukree wouldn't let this drag him down. If he only had five or ten years to live, then he better make it the best five to ten years anyone has ever lived.He thanked the druids and left the mountains to start his adventure. Who knew that an adventure was also looking for him – while stopping at Baldur's Gate, he was kidnapped by the mind flayers and woke up in a pod with a worm in his head!At least this time he didn't lose his memory. And he met a bunch of cool friends from the ship. Everyone wants to get rid of the brain worms, and Sukree is more than happy to oblige. It seems urgent enough. What does he have to lose anyway?
